Kernel: Split BlockBasedFileSystem off FileBackedFileSystem

FileBackedFileSystem is one that's backed by (mounted from) a file, in other
words one that has a "source" of the mount; that doesn't mean it deals in
blocks. The hierarchy now becomes:

* FS
  * ProcFS
  * DevPtsFS
  * TmpFS
  * FileBackedFS
    * (future) Plan9FS
    * BlockBasedFS
      * Ext2FS
